This Friday he arrived at the International Airport of Maiquetia “Simon Bolivar” flight number 142 of the Grand Mission Back to the Homeland program, coming from Miami, United States, with a total of 156 Venezuelans. According to the information disseminated by the Ministry of Interior, Justice and Peace on its Telegram channel, 94 men, 37 women, two adolescents and 23 minors are in the group of returnees.
